Tsudakhar (; ) is a rural locality (a selo) and the administrative centre of Tsudakharsky Selsoviet, Levashinsky District, Republic of Dagestan, Russia. The population was 1,355 as of 2010. There are 6 streets.
== Geography == Tsudakhar is located 27 km southwest of Levashi (the district's administrative centre) by road, on the Kazikumukhskoye Koysu River. Inkuchimakhi and Karekadani are the nearest rural localities.
